Transaction 901644d43dee607be35167e5e4062dfe9ce39c4ddcc16f1557fc148bebe12683
1 Input
2 Outputs
- 901644d43dee607be35167e5e4062dfe9ce39c4ddcc16f1557fc148bebe12683:0
- 901644d43dee607be35167e5e4062dfe9ce39c4ddcc16f1557fc148bebe12683:1
value 417180
address 3AojDfu7PtA7ekSMofGbmH7DSV7AdwZ4xF
value 4616803
address 1KabXW2PJ8jSUHycQRtXDaXoKjYtqn3ARQ